On June 13th, I adopted a Labrador/golden retriever/German shepherd mix named Monty, and was informed that he has a Class II Malocclusion, AKA an overbite. This isn't uncommon in all 3 breeds.

Included is a breakdown of costs involved, as estimated by the only dog dentist in my city. Most of the cost comes from anesthesia. I have someone who will stay with him to provide surgical aftercare when I return to work. Medications alone will be $207.92. He'll need a dental check-up a few months after the surgery, but I hope to have full time work by then.  I understood the costs of adopting a dog when I got Monty, but a dental complication this early was a shock.

Because he still has his baby teeth, there is no scheduled surgery date. However, he will need it when he is around 6-7 months old (October-November 2020).
